10-Year Plan to
End Chronic Homelessness
in Sacramento County is now Sacramento Steps Forward

The Plan

Vision
Sacramento County residents will have permanent housing and access to resources or support services necessary to prevent or break the cycle of chronic homelessness.

Mission
Prevent, and eventually eliminate, chronic homelessness by providing permanent housing and coordinated services to help individuals achieve maximum self-sufficiency.

Guiding Principle
Solving the community-wide challenges associated with homelessness requires visionary leadership; commitment to the goal of ending, not just managing homelessness; and partnership among all jurisdictions, as well as among faith-based, private and civic organizations.

Essential Components
The essential components to solving the problems of homelessness are:

  1. Housing First
  2. Outreach and Central Intake
  3. Prevention
  4. Leadership
  5. Evaluation and Reporting to the Community
